Output 66defdd390f568c8903f44ecb859d7a4934de3a8655fc4dde660116930f931d5:1

value
1105134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a353e9ea5fcb6052fcec9fc71d27f76b003c842 OP_EQUAL
address
39uzXJrpuJ2S6eSqkhgdnvzP7Cci4nikxL
transaction
66defdd390f568c8903f44ecb859d7a4934de3a8655fc4dde660116930f931d5
spent
true